evan lewisEvan D. Lewis, 87, of Bickford Cottage, Clinton, IA, formerly of Albany, IL, died Saturday, November 25, 2017, at Bickford Cottage.

Evan was born September 2, 1930, in Tampico, IL, to Walter and Lucille (Drury) Lewis. He was educated in the Erie, IL, grade schools and graduated from Erie High School. He served in the U. S. Navy during the Korean Conflict. On October 19, 1958, he married Mary Jane Ryder. She died June 8, 2007. Evan was a lineman at Interstate Power in Clinton. He then worked at FS in Lyndon, IL, and lastly for 3M in Cordova, IL, retiring after 23 years. Evan also served as the Tax Assessor for Whiteside County. He was a member of the Albany United Methodist Church and a past Commander of the Hanson/Kennedy Albany American Legion Post #1079. He was a volunteer fire fighter with the Albany Fire Department, a member of the Fulton Masonic Lodge, and a member of the Albany Lions Club. He also served on the Riverbend School Board. Evan was instrumental in developing the youth baseball program in Albany. He enjoyed golfing and was a member of the Fulton Country Club.

Survivors include one daughter, Cathy Bell of Marion, OH; one son, Marty (Patti) Lewis of Albany; one granddaughter, Annie Bell; one step-granddaughter, Jennifer (Nate) Yarbrough; two step-great grandchildren; two sisters, Mrs. Mary Alice Evans of Morton, IL, and Agnes (Jim) Knowlsen of California; one brother, Albert (Sandy) Lewis of Morrison, IL; one nephew, Tom (Joyce) Tegeler of Albany.

He was preceded in death by his parents; his wife, Mary Jane; two sisters, Gracia Burgess and Margaret Bradshaw.
